    SUMMARY

    Works with the Director of Physical Plant to direct, organize, and perform the activities of the Maintenance, Custodial, and Grounds operations at the South Plains College Plainview Center.

    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

    Duties include, but are not limited to the following functions.

    • Perform custodial duties on a daily basis as well as supervise custodial services.
    • Perform Maintenance activities daily and on an as-needed basis.
    • Perform Grounds activities on a scheduled basis.
    • Plan, prioritize, assign, supervise, and review work of employees assigned to them.
    • Evaluate employee performance; work with employees to correct deficiencies.
    • Recommend and assist in the implementation of goals and objectives, establishes schedules, methods, and procedures for the services provided.

    Custodial Duties

    • Sweeps, mops, scrubs, vacuums, wax, and buff floors as required.
    • Clean windows, restrooms, offices, classrooms, labs, and common areas as required.
    • Empty trash and garbage receptacles on a daily basis or more frequent if required.

    Maintenance Duties

    • Perform general maintenance work in alteration, repair and maintenance of floors, roofs, walls, doors, windows, and other structures.
    • Utilize power equipment and hand tools as needed.
    • Repair tables, benches, cabinets, furniture, bookshelves, desks, counters, and other equipment.
    • Perform basic electrical repairs. (changing bulbs, receptacles, breakers, as well as basic troubleshooting of electrical systems)
    • Perform basic plumbing repairs. (changing flush valves, faucets, shut-offs, operating drain cleaning equipment.
    • Maintain records for fire alarms system, fire sprinkler system, and hand held fire extinguishers.

    Grounds Maintenance Duties

    • Perform daily trash clearing on campus grounds.
    • Perform weed eating, spraying, and weed removal as required.
    • Perform mowing on a weekly basis or as needed.
    • Maintain the irrigation system and ensure proper water scheduling is adhered to.
    • Ensure parking signage is in good repair.
    • Ensure gutters are clean operational at all times.
    • Maintain records for back-flow preventers for irrigation system.

    QUALIFICATIONS

    To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ge, skill, and/or ability required.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ions. Must have a current Texas Driver's License and be able to meet driving history requirements as far as insurance requirements. Basic computer skills are required. Familiarity with safety codes and OSHA are highly preferred.

    EDUCATION

    High School Diploma or GED. Associates Degree or higher preferred.

    EXPERIENCE

    Three years of skilled experience. Three years of supervisory experience.

    LANGUAGE SKILLS

    Ability to read and comprehend simple instructions, short correspondence, and memos. Ability to write simple correspondence. Ability to effectively present information in one-on-one and small group situations to students, faculty, and other employees of the college.

    MATHEMATICAL SKILLS

    Ability to apply concepts such as fractions, percentages, ratios, and proportions to practical situations.

    REASONING ABILITY

    Ability to solve practical problems and deal with a variety of concrete variables in situations where only limited standardization exists. Ability to interpret a variety of instructions furnished in written, oral, diagram, or schedule form.

    WORKING CONDITIONS

    Working conditions are considered acceptable, but occasional exposure to one or more disagreeable elements such as dirt, dust, chemicals, inclement weather, and other hazards of maintenance equipment.

    PHYSICAL DEMANDS

    The physical demands described are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job. While performing the duties of this job, the employee is regularly required to walk, stand, utilize fingers, hands, handle, and feel. Must have the ability to push and pull objects with hands, reach with hands and arms, move hands in a circular motion, climb ladders to high places, stoop, kneel, crouch, crawl, and talk or hear for eight hours or more. The employee must regularly lift and/or move up to 25 pounds, frequently lift and/or move up to 50 pounds, and occasionally lift and/or move over 100 pounds assisted. Specific vision abilities required by this job include close vision, distant vision, peripheral vision, and depth perception.
